Air Fryer Tahini Sauce - Creamy, Toasty, and Fast

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es
Servings: 6 servings

Ingredients
  

  • Raw tahini (well-stirred): 1/2 cup
  • Fresh lemon juice: 3–4 tablespoons (about 1 large lemon)
  • Garlic: 1 large clove (or 2 small), grated or very finely minced
  • Water: 1/4 to 1/2 cup, as needed to thin
  • Olive oil: 1 tablespoon (optional, for extra silkiness)
  • Ground cumin: 1/2 teaspoon
  • Fine sea salt: 1/2 teaspoon, plus more to taste
  • Black pepper: a few grinds
  • Optional add-ins: 2 tablespoons plain Greek yogurt, pinch of smoked paprika, pinch of cayenne, or a drizzle of honey
  • Fresh herbs (optional): chopped parsley or cilantro, for serving

Method
 

  1. Preheat the air fryer. Set to 300°F (150°C). You want gentle heat—nothing scorching.
  2. Prep your garlic. Grate or mince it as fine as you can. Fine pieces mellow quickly and blend smoothly.
  3. Warm the aromatics. Place the garlic on a small piece of foil or in a shallow, oven-safe ramekin with 1 teaspoon olive oil. Air fry for 3–4 minutes until just fragrant and slightly softened. Avoid browning.
  4. Loosen the tahini. Stir your tahini jar well. In a heat-safe bowl, whisk the tahini with lemon juice. It will seize and thicken—this is normal.
  5. Add warm water gradually. Whisk in 2–3 tablespoons warm water at a time until the sauce turns smooth and pourable. Aim for a texture like heavy cream for drizzling or a bit thicker for dipping.
  6. Season it up. Whisk in the softened garlic, cumin, salt, pepper, and olive oil (if using). Taste and adjust: more lemon for brightness, more salt for punch, or a pinch of sugar/honey if it tastes too sharp.
  7. Optional air fryer finish. For deeper flavor, place the bowl back in the air fryer at 250–275°F (120–135°C) for 3–4 minutes, stirring halfway. This warms the sauce and lightly toasts the tahini without drying it out.
  8. Serve. Drizzle over roasted carrots, broccoli, cauliflower, salmon, chicken, or grain bowls. Sprinkle with herbs and a dusting of paprika if you like.
